Role Overview
In collaboration with Heroix, the Client is seeking an IT Systems Support Engineer to join its technology function, playing a key role in ensuring the stability, availability, and efficient operation of core banking and infrastructure systems.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ting day-to-day IT operations, assisting with system administration tasks, and contributing to the smooth running of critical business processes, including scheduled system cycles and infrastructure maintenance. This role also involves providing hands-on technical support to end users and collaborating closely with wider IT teams to improve service delivery and operational efficiency.

Key Responsibilities

  • Systems Operations: Execute routine operational procedures across core banking and business platforms, including end-of-day processing activities and scheduled evening and weekend system tasks.
  • IT Support Services: Provide first-line and second-line technical assistance for desktop and laptop environments, covering both hardware and software issues, while supporting continuous improvement of helpdesk processes.
  • Infrastructure Maintenance: Assist in maintaining the stability and performance of IT infrastructure, including servers, systems, and related business applications, to ensure optimal functionality.
  • User & Network Administration: Manage user accounts, access permissions, and directory services, while supporting network administration activities including Active Directory, DNS, and DHCP environments.
  • Data & Continuity Support: Carry out backup procedures, restore operations, disaster recovery testing, and routine system checks, ensuring accurate documentation and system reliability at all times.

Qualifications, Skills, and Attributes

  • Education: A recognised qualification such as an MCAST diploma or university degree in Information and Communication Technology or a related discipline.
  • Experience: Previous exposure to IT support or technical operations roles is preferred, ideally within a structured or regulated environment.
  • Language Skills: Excellent command of English is required to succeed in this role. The ability to communicate in Maltese would be an asset.
  • Communication Skills: Ability to convey technical information clearly and effectively to non-technical users, with strong listening skills and a customer-focused approach.
  • Interpersonal Skills: Confident and collaborative team player capable of building positive working relationships across departments.
  • Technical Skills: Familiarity with Microsoft SQL Server Reporting Services, SQL scripting (T-SQL), Microsoft Office 365, Active Directory, DNS, and DHCP. Exposure to database or application development concepts would be beneficial.
  • Organisation: Strong ability to manage multiple tasks, prioritise effectively, and maintain accurate records of system activities and checks.
  • Self-Motivated: Proactive mindset with a willingness to learn, adapt to new systems, and develop expertise within banking technologies and processes.
  • Problem-Solving: Logical thinker with strong analytical skills and the ability to diagnose and resolve technical issues efficiently.
